Exploring sexuality – what does that even mean? And how do you do it, especially after having been in a long term relationship? In this episode, Anne-Marie Zanzal and Barbara Rowlandson discuss the complexities of exploring one's sexuality, particularly for those who may be coming out later in life or questioning their identity. Anne-Marie and Barbara emphasize the importance of curiosity, courage, and self-reflection in this journey, while also addressing societal expectations and the concept of compulsory heterosexuality.

❓ What to Expect in This Episode:

🔍How compulsory heteronormativity affects many people's perceptions of their identity.

🪞Why self-reflection is crucial in understanding one's sexual orientation.

🗺️How personal experiences can serve as catalysts for exploration.

👥Understanding one's feelings and sensations is key to exploration.


 Why This Matters:

It's important when exploring your sexuality to investigate the impact of patriarchal norms on women's identities and relationships, the importance of exploring one's sexuality, and the role of media in shaping perceptions of queerness. This episode underscores the need for self-discovery, curiosity, and community support in navigating the complexities of sexual identity, particularly for those coming out later in life.

It can feel incredibly isolating to question your sexuality after years of living a different story. Coming Out & Beyond Support for Women Questioning Their Sexuality Later in Life is a companion for that specific journey, created for those who find themselves navigating these waters from a place of established life-perhaps within a marriage, after a divorce, or while building a family. Host Anne-Marie Zanzal brings her perspective as an ordained minister and hospice chaplain to conversations that gently unravel complex layers of identity, faith, and fear. This podcast delves into the real, often unspoken challenges: confronting compulsory heterosexuality, processing religious or spiritual conditioning, and managing the anxiety of how a personal revelation might ripple through your closest relationships. Episodes offer a blend of personal reflection, insightful interviews, and practical support, focusing on emotional and mental well-being without offering simplistic answers. It’s a space where you can hear stories that resonate with your own, fostering a sense of clarity and community. Tuning in, you’ll find a resource that honors the full spectrum of this experience-the confusion, the liberation, and everything in between-always grounded in compassion and deep understanding.
